## Creating a High-Value Guest Experience
When you host, you are transitioning from a private owner to a hospitality provider. This requires a shift in how you maintain your pool deck and surrounding landscape. Guests in DeKalb prioritize shade and restroom access. Providing a "dry path" to a dedicated restroom or an outdoor changing hut is one of the fastest ways to increase your hourly rate and earn five-star reviews.
| Amenity Level | Features Included | Recommended Hourly Rate (DeKalb) |
| :--- | :--- | :--- |
| Basic | Clean pool, ladder access, 2 lounge chairs | $35 - $45 |
| Standard | Pool, 4+ chairs, large umbrella, Bluetooth speaker | $50 - $65 |
| Premium | Heated pool, grill access, fire pit, private restroom | $75 - $110+ |
## The Step-by-Step Path to Hosting
1. **Audit Your Equipment:** Ensure your pump, filter, and heater are in peak condition. A mechanical failure in mid-July could cost you thousands in lost bookings during the busiest month of the year.
2. **Standardize Your Chemistry:** With high swimmer loads, your chlorine demand will fluctuate. Implement a testing schedule—once before a booking and once after—to ensure the water remains crystal clear and sanitized.
3. **Establish Your House Rules:** Clearly define what is and isn't allowed. This includes music volume, maximum capacity, and whether or not children or pets are permitted.
4. **Define Your Grill and Food Policy:** Many hosts in DeKalb find that allowing the use of a propane grill attracts longer bookings (3-4 hours), significantly increasing total guest spend per visit.
5. **Optimize Your Listing for the Season:** Because of the seasonal nature of Illinois swimming, start your listings in early May to capture "Early Bird" bookings for June graduations and July 4th celebrations.
## Managing Safety and Compliance
Safety is the foundation of a successful hosting business. In DeKalb, this means adhering to local fencing ordinances and ensuring your pool deck is non-slip. You should provide clear signage regarding "No Diving" in shallow areas and keep a life ring or reach pole in plain sight. Every guest interaction should begin with a brief orientation on where emergency shut-offs are located and where the first aid kit is kept.
## Curating Your Backyard Environment
To separate yourself from a public pool, focus on the "vibe" of your space. DeKalb's landscape can sometimes feel exposed. Installing lattice privacy screens or planting tall perennials can create a secluded sanctuary feel. If you have a patio area, consider the "flow" of movement. People shouldn't have to walk through wet areas to get to the grill or the seating. Keeping these zones distinct prevents accidents and keeps your deck looking organized throughout the day.

## How This Affects Pool Rental Hosts
Renting out your pool in a town like DeKalb requires a focused approach to property management. Because you are inviting strangers into your private space, the "quality of the host" is just as important as the "quality of the pool." As a host, you will find that your attention to detail in the backyard impacts your reputation within the community.
Hosting affects your daily routine during the summer months. You'll need to develop a quick-turnaround cleaning process. Typically, this involves a 15-minute window between bookings to skim the surface, reset the furniture, and empty skimmer baskets. This "turnover" is the most critical part of the job. For DeKalb hosts, the short season means every hour counts. If you can automate your robotic vacuum and keep your chemical levels steady with a salt chlorine generator or a reliable feeder, the physical labor involved remains minimal compared to the financial reward.

### Q: How do I handle restroom access for guests?
You have three main options: provide access to a designated bathroom inside your home via a direct entrance, provide an outdoor portable restroom (common for high-volume hosts), or list your pool as "No Restroom Provided" at a lower price point. Most successful DeKalb hosts find that providing a clean, indoor-access bathroom allows for much higher hourly rates.

### Q: How do I handle noise complaints from neighbors?
Transparency is key. We suggest informing your neighbors that you will be hosting occasional, supervised guests. Setting clear "Quiet Hours" and maximum capacity limits in your house rules helps prevent noise issues before they start. Most guests are looking for a relaxing dip, not a loud party.
### Q: Does my pool need to be heated to be a host?
While not required, a heater is highly recommended in DeKalb. Illinois mornings can be cool even in July. Pools that are kept at a consistent 82-85 degrees receive significantly more bookings and higher ratings than unheated pools.
